The US policy towards the region of the Caspian Sea, including Azerbaijan will be discussed in Washington DC this week.

A number of prominent US experts and former officials dealing with the Caspian region will gather together to discuss US priorities on the Caspian Sea, as well as the current challenges.

The discussions will be held at School of Advanced International Studies (SAIS) of Johns Hopkins University, on Thursday, February 11th.

Among the main participants will be Brenda Shaffer, professor in the School of Political Science at the University of Haifa, C.

Boyden Gray, former U.S. ambassador to the European Union; Alexandros Petersen, associate director of the Eurasia Energy Center at the Atlantic Council, and Svante Cornell, research director at the SAIS Central Asia-Caucasus Institute.

The event organizers told US analysts are currently interested in one question: "Does U.S. have a policy Caspian?". According to the organizers, there is a need for US to focus on the questions around NABUCO, issues of energy security, US should pay attention to those questions.
